One thing I always notice when I see an E36 are the little rows of bumps on the inside side. Those are there to remove wind noise and I always thought them to be a cool detail. Lastly the locks should always be assembled with plenty of powdered graphite to keep them working smooth for a long time. Any kind of liquid lubricant will only dirty up your key/pocket and will attract dust. A small tube of powdered graphite is available at Lowes or Home Depot where they sell keys.   • Love the LPL reference. I've rekeyed more than one lock cylinder in a vintage car, great job figuring it out! Fwiw, if you don't have the correct tumblers for the keys as you did, you can just delete a tumbler. You can also modify individual tumblers using a file in some cases.
